Description MTI Dental, located in Coatesville, PA, is a World Leader in the manufacturing of dental handpieces and one of just a few companies who can say that we are Made in the USA. Our products deliver an unsurpassed blend of exceptional reliability and high performance for everyday use in both dental operatory and laboratory procedures. With an emphasis on greater value, our handpieces are defined by straightforward design and excellent durability. We also have a handpiece repair division that we are looking to expand. We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Dental Handpiece Repair Technician to join our team.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ience assembling, rebuilding, and repairing all brands and types of pneumatic and electric dental handpieces and attachments. This position requires precision, technical aptitude, and a strong commitment to quality workmanship. Key Responsibilities Disassemble, inspect, repair, and reassemble a variety of dental handpieces (high-speed, low-speed, electric, and attachments). Diagnose mechanical and electrical issues and perform necessary repairs or component replacements. Test and calibrate equipment to ensure proper functionality and compliance with performance standards. Maintain accurate repair records and documentation. Follow established quality control and safety procedures. Communicate effectively with team members and supervisors regarding repair status or technical issues. Stay current on new models, technologies, and repair techniques across all major brands. Requirements Previous experience in dental handpiece repair or small mechanical/electrical assembly preferred. Strong mechanical aptitude and manual dexterity. Ability to read and interpret technical manuals and diagrams. High attention to detail and quality workmanship. Reliable, self-motivated, and able to manage time efficiently. Basic computer skills for recordkeeping and communication. Preferred Skills Experience with both pneumatic and electric handpieces (KaVo, NSK, Midwest, Star, Bien-Air, etc.). Familiarity with micrometers, gauges, and other precision measuring tools. Knowledge of dental equipment and industry standards.
